...pretty much sums up the day. Went out with a fun crew for 20, began limping after about 6 or 7 miles, walked/ hobbled in the last few. Probably the most pain I've had while running since I ran on a broken foot. The entire knee froze up and I felt unable to move it. Luckily I was able to get a massage in immediately after, and with some myofascial release, ice, heat, and laser therapy I can at least again bend my knee.

In the spirit of being less bitter (I know, who is writing this right?) I am glad I went out today. As much as it sucks feeling like all the healing progress I've made in the last 2 weeks is gone, I am glad because today's run confirmed the diagnosis of the popliteus injury (definitely not a PCL). That little muscle is also easily injured upon impact. Today it seized up on me, which then tightened all the ligaments around my knee, which immobilized my knee and caused excrutiaing pain. 

The massage therapist was able to get the ligaments limber again and then work on the popliteus as well. The injured knee was substantially more swollen and stiff than my other one. I have again regained range of motion, it's just painful still.

In other news, my knee felt great. Pain fluctuated between a 1-2 for the first 5 and dropped down to a 1 the 2nd 5. I woke up half hour early to spend 20mins heating it and to have some time for squats and lunges before the run- it does so much better warm and with the muscles ready.

I haven't been adding this on, but since last Wednesday I've been working my arse off trying to get my knee healed. The PT stretches, icing, heating, and strengthening takes 1-3 hours a day. About 45 mins of it is entirely useless (so it feels) doing weird weightless moves with my leg and stretching everything around it. I've started some homeopathics, with a couple more that are supposed to arrive tomorrow. Add to that the extra vitamin C, multi-vitamin, and herbal muscle relaxants.... yeah. But the aggressive combo is working! My opposite shin (compensation injury) now hurts more than my actual injury, and even that's improving after some trigger point massage.
